On asymptotic solutions of systems of differential equations with deviating argument in certain critical cases

S. D. Furta


Abstract: Sufficient conditions are found for the existence of particular solutions of the system
$$ \dot x(t) =f\bigl(x(t),x(t+t_1),\dots,x(t+t_k)\bigr),\qquad x\in \mathbb R^n, $$
that converge to the critical point $x=0$ as $t\to+\infty$ or as $t\to-\infty$, but not exponentially.
